Manchester taxis run two separate tariffs. The day rate applies between 6am and 10pm. The night rate, which is higher, runs from 10pm to 6am. Bank holidays also trigger the night rate.

These are the approved maximum rates for licensed hackney carriages in Manchester
| Rate Element | Day Tariff (6am–10pm) | Night Tariff (10pm–6am) |
|---|---|---|
| Base / Starting Fare | £3.40 | £3.80 |
| Effective Cost Per Mile | Approx £2.61/mile | Approx £3.20/mile |
| 1 Mile Journey | Around £5.80 | Around £6.80 |
| 3 Mile Journey | Around £11–£13 | Around £14–£17 |
| 5 Mile Journey | Around £16–£19 | Around £20–£25 |
| 10 Mile Journey | Around £25–£32 | Around £32–£42 |
| Waiting Time (per hour) | Approx £22.80 | Approx £30.20 |
| Extra Passenger Charge | 20p per person | 20p per person |
| Airport Surcharge | Around £1.80 | Around £1.80 |
| Bank Holiday / Christmas | Night tariff applies | Night rate + up to 50% |
| Out of Area (beyond 4 miles) | Agreed fixed fare with driver before journey | |
Source: Manchester City Council official hackney carriage tariff (effective November 2023, in force 2026). Private hire firms may charge different rates agreed at booking.
Small things can make a noticeable difference to what you end up paying
The night tariff kicks in at 10pm and the meter runs noticeably faster. If your journey is close to that cutoff, leaving just before can save you a few pounds on the same route.
Licensed private hire operators like RidexTaxis offer fixed pre-agreed fares for many journeys. That means no meter surprises if you hit unexpected traffic or need to make a quick stop on the way.
A taxi carrying four people works out significantly cheaper per person than four separate rides. For airport trips or nights out, splitting the journey cost between your group is always worth considering.
Check the approximate distance on Google Maps before you travel. This helps you understand whether a quoted fare is reasonable and gives you a clear starting point when comparing operators.
Bank holidays trigger the night tariff all day. During Christmas and New Year periods, some operators apply an additional surcharge on top of the night rate. Factor this into your plans if travel can be flexible.
For journeys beyond 4 miles outside Manchester city limits, the meter is not compulsory. Always ask the driver to confirm the fixed fare before you set off so there are no disagreements at the other end.

For most journeys within the city, you are looking at a starting fare of £3.40 during the day, then around £2.61 per mile after that. A typical 3 mile trip across Manchester city centre runs between £11 and £13 in daytime. Night journeys cost around 25 to 30 percent more. Pre-booked private hire operators may offer different fixed rates, which you should always confirm before travel.
The night tariff applies between 10pm and 6am every day. During this period, the starting fare increases to £3.80 and the meter runs faster, giving an effective rate of around £3.20 per mile. Bank holidays also trigger the night tariff all day. During the Christmas and New Year period, some operators apply a further uplift on top of the night rate, so it is always worth asking before getting in.
The journey from Manchester city centre to Manchester Airport is roughly 10 miles. During the day you can expect to pay between £25 and £32, depending on traffic and your exact pickup point. At night that rises to around £32 to £42. Pre-booking a private hire vehicle in advance often gives you a fixed fare, which many passengers prefer for airport journeys where timing matters.
Yes. Manchester City Council sets maximum fares for licensed hackney carriage taxis operating within its boundary. These are published on the council website and must be displayed on a fare card inside every licensed taxi. The meter is required for all journeys starting within the city that end within 4 miles of the city boundary. Beyond that limit, fares should be agreed with the driver before setting off.
A hackney carriage is a black cab or similar licensed vehicle that can be hailed on the street or picked up from a taxi rank. It uses a metered fare regulated by the council. A private hire vehicle must be pre-booked through an operator and cannot be hailed. The fare is agreed at booking, which means you know the cost before you travel. Yes, when you pre-book through a licensed private hire operator. The fare is agreed at the point of booking and does not change based on traffic or route. This is one of the main reasons people choose to book ahead rather than hailing a cab on the street, particularly for longer journeys or airport trips where budget planning matters.
Yes, Manchester hackney carriage tariff includes a 20p surcharge per additional passenger beyond the first. For a group of four, that adds 60p to the metered fare. For pre-booked private hire vehicles, the fare is usually quoted for the whole vehicle rather than per person, so there is no additional charge for carrying a full car of passengers.

Most licensed taxis in Manchester accept card payments. Manchester City Council has updated its tariff guidance to state that no additional surcharge can be added for card payments, so you should pay the metered fare regardless of how you settle the bill. Some older drivers may still carry card readers with a small fee, though this is becoming less common. Always check before getting in if this matters to you.
